Tax Considerations and Insurance Needs
Estate preparation in California often involves navigating intricate tax regulations. An official appraisal is called for by the internal revenue service if the total worth of the estate surpasses particular limits, or if you prepare to give away considerable items to a museum or not-for-profit for a tax deduction. These records should adhere to certain guidelines to be accepted. A straightforward verbal estimate or an informal "cost" method will certainly not be enough for government filings.
Insurance policy is one more location where a current appraisal is crucial. Numerous common homeowners' policies in the Bay Area have limitations on "components" that could not cover a premium art collection. If a pipe bursts in a historic Piedmont home or a wildfire risk requires a quick emptying, you need to know that your investments are completely secured. An evaluation gives the evidence of value required to arrange private products on an insurance coverage advance, making sure that you can recoup the complete replacement cost if the unimaginable takes place.
The Refine of Examining Your Collection
The actual process of an assessment generally starts with a physical evaluation. An expert will certainly see the home to take measurements, photograph each item, and note the condition. They will certainly search for signs of reconstruction, damages, or wear that could not be visible to the inexperienced eye. After the onsite see, the appraiser hangs around investigating sales documents from across the nation and the world to locate similar things that have offered recently.
This research study stage is where real worth of an expert becomes clear. They have accessibility to databases and archives that are not constantly find here available to the general public. They can compare an original print and a high-grade reproduction, or determine a particular duration in a musician's career that is presently in high need. Once the research study is full, you receive an extensive written record that information each thing, its history, and its appraised value. This paper becomes a long-term part of the estate's records.
